My little sister is bullying me. What do I do?

What am I supposed to do when my biggest bully is my 9 yr. old sister? I'm graduating high school soon and I have to deal with her when I get home. She's always threatening me and acting like my smug and vicious bullies that I had to deal with in the 6th grade. I can't defend myself because I'll get in trouble for "picking" on my younger sibling. I can't talk to my parents, because they'll tell me to suck it up and just walk away. I can't talk to my grandmother because she'll take the side of "Y'all need to love one another and stop fighting all the time." No one seems to get my point except my boyfriend, who says I should just have nothing to do with her until she grows up some. I love her to the end of the world and back because she's my little sister, but at the same time I just want to lay her out. I've started having emotional breakdowns like I had when I was 8-13 when my bullies were doing their worst. I can't start having breakdowns because of a 9 year old sibling that thinks she's the cutest little princess of everything.
